RYA Small Craft First Aid


One Day Theory Course

Course Details

Duration: 1 Day

Previous experience required: None

Content: Basic First Aid Procedures.

It's the middle of the night and you are halfway across the channel - when one of your crew suddenly collapses. Would you know what to do? The RYA small craft First Aid course is designed to teach you exactly what to do in these situations. From the minor ailments such as headaches, sunburn and small lesions through to the immediate response to serious medical emergencies, the course covers most situations that a yachtsman is likely to encounter. There is particular emphasis on resuscitation techniques and the "first care" of a man over board victim. Our instructor will explain the procedures for obtaining outside medical assistance and he can also advise you on the correct first aid equipment for your own boat. This course is a must for all who sail, and skippers should encourage their crews to attend. Remember it may be you who needs attention! At the completion of the course you will be issued with the RYA small craft first aid certificate. This certificate is valid for 3 years from the time of issue and is a prerequisite for those taking the Yachtmaster Offshore Examination.
